Shikimic Acid (3,4,5-trihydroxy-1-cyclohexene-1-carboxylic acid) is a vital organic compound occurring naturally in many vascular plants and microbes. As the defining monomer of the Shikimate Pathway, it serves as the biosynthetical precursor for the aromatic amino acids L-phenylalanine, L-tyrosine, and L-tryptophan. This fundamental biological role translates into extensive value across global industries, making it a highly sought-after chemical raw material.
Shikimic acid serves as the indispensable starting material for the synthesis of Oseltamivir Phosphate (Tamiflu), a neuraminidase inhibitor widely deployed globally for the prevention and treatment of influenza strains (H1N1, H5N1).
Utilized in food formulations for its antioxidant qualities and as a precursor to organic flavour compounds. It acts as an clean-label ingredient preserving lipid stability in various food matrices.
Leveraged for skin-brightening and anti-acne formulations, shikimic acid acts as an effective yet gentle exfoliator, showing properties comparable to glycolic acid but with reduced skin irritation profile.
For decades, China has been the epicenter of global Shikimic Acid production, primarily driven by rich forestry resources of star anise (Illicium verum) in southern provinces. However, climate dependency, crop seasonality, and environmental shifts have historically introduced volatility in supply chains. As global demands scale, modern factories are implementing dual-sourcing methodologies to guarantee stability in both quality and quantity.

Two distinct industrial pathways dominate the manufacturing landscape of Shikimic Acid. Understanding the pros and cons of each is crucial for technical buyers and R&D managers looking to secure materials alignment with product clean-label guidelines or cost targets.
| Feature Parameter | Star Anise Extraction (Natural Pathway) | Microbial Bio-Fermentation (Biosynthetic Pathway) |
|---|---|---|
| Raw Material Origin | Dried pods of Illicium verum (Star Anise) | Glucose/Carbon source utilizing engineered Escherichia coli or Yeast |
| Purity Levels | Typically >98% (HPLC) | >99% (HPLC) |
| Carbon Footprint | Low direct carbon, agricultural dependency | High energy input for bioreactors, low spatial footprint |
| Heavy Metals Control | Requires stringent soil and crop oversight | Easily controlled through sterile synthetic nutrients |
| Supply Stability | Subject to harvest yields, weather, seasonal pricing | Highly predictable year-round production runs |

Shikimic acid performs exceptionally well across various parameters when integrated into specific formulations. Below are the key target matrices:
In beverages and food preservation, Shikimic Acid serves as a natural synergistic antioxidant. It enhances the preservative capabilities of ascorbic acid, preventing color degradation in plant-based juices.
Applied at concentrations of 1.0% to 3.0% in chemical peels and anti-aging lotions. Its pKa matches skin exfoliation requirements without damaging the epidermal moisture barrier, accelerating skin cell turnover safely.
For synthetic antiviral drugs, high-purity Shikimic Acid powder serves as the foundational chiral block. Factories optimize crystal morphology to ensure maximum reactant yield during synthetic organic steps.
